Background
Jolson, Alfred James was born on June 18, 1928 in Bridgeport, Connecticut, United States. Son of Alfred James and Justine Elizabeth (Houlihan) Jolson.

Bachelor, Boston College, 1951. Master of Arts, Boston College, 1952. Blekinge Institute of Technology, Weston College, 1958.
Master of Business Administration, Harvard University, 1962. Doctor of Philosophy, Gregorian University, Rome, 1970. Doctor of Humane Letters (honorary), Wheeling Jesuit University, West Virginia, 1990.
Teacher, Baghdad (Iraq) College, 1952-1955; professor, dean, Al-hikma U., Baghdad, 1962-1964; dean, Boston College, Newton, Massachusetts, 1964-1968; dean, professor, School Social Workers, Salisbury, Rhodesia, 1970-1976; dean, professor, St. Joseph U., Philadelphia, 1976-1986; dean, professor, Wheeling (West Virginia) Jesuit College, 1986-1987; bishop, Reykjavik, Iceland, since 1987.
Chairman board directors St. Joseph's Prep School, Philadelphia, 1979-1984. Board directors St. Joseph's University, Philadelphia, 1978-1979. Member Knights of Holy Sepulcher.
